How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Geneseo?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Geneseo Studio Apartments | $1,250 | $1,100 | $1,490 |
| Geneseo 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,623 | $880 | $2,145 |
| Geneseo 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,897 | $980 | $2,600 |
| Geneseo 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,312 | $1,550 | $3,124 |
| Geneseo 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,821 | $1,700 | $3,240 |
